-  Early Literacy Development: An Overview – This unit will provide a comprehensive understanding of early literacy development, focusing on the critical skills children need to become successful readers.
- &ensph;Phonological Awareness and Phonics: Theory and Instruction – This unit will delve into the theories and instructional strategies for teaching phonological awareness and phonics, essential components of early literacy.
-  Vocabulary and Comprehension Strategies for Emergent Readers – This unit will explore strategies to build vocabulary and comprehension skills in emergent readers, focusing on evidence-based practices.
-  Assessment and Evaluation in Early Literacy – This unit will cover various assessment tools and techniques to evaluate early literacy skills and strategies for using assessment data to inform instruction.
-  Culturally Responsive Teaching in Early Literacy – This unit will examine the role of culture in early literacy development and provide strategies for creating culturally responsive early literacy instruction.
-  Digital Literacy and Early Reading – This unit will explore the intersection of digital literacy and early reading, including the benefits and challenges of using technology to support early literacy development.
-  Early Literacy Interventions – This unit will examine various early literacy interventions, including strategies for preventing and addressing reading difficulties in young children.
-  Instructional Design for Early Literacy – This unit will provide an overview of instructional design principles and how they can be applied to early literacy instruction.
-  Collaboration and Family Engagement in Early Literacy – This unit will emphasize the importance of collaboration and family engagement in early literacy development and provide strategies for fostering partnerships between schools, families, and communities.
